2025年クリスマスコンサート✨🎄帯広・釧路・旭川・札幌✨

今年も、いよいよあと2ヶ月!


今年最後のイベントは、

みんな大好きクリスマスコンサートとお楽しみ会です♪


開催会場は、豪華4ヶ所!

帯広・釧路・旭川・札幌です🎻✨

みなさんと楽しい音楽体験や、

音のおもちゃで遊ぼう!のコーナーもご用意しています♪

ぜひご家族でお越しください🎄


【開催日時・会場】

帯広 11月29日(土)

受付:13:30〜

開演:14:00〜

会場:十勝リハビリテーションセンター敷地内

交流スペース「星のひろば」



釧路 11月30日(日)

受付:10:00〜

開始:10:30〜

会場:釧路市生涯学習センターまなぼっと幣舞

音楽スタジオA


旭川 12月14日(日)

受付:10:00〜

開始:10:30〜

会場:旭川市市民活動交流センターCoCoDe「ホール」


札幌 12月21日(日)

受付:10:30〜

開始:11:00〜

会場:北翔大学 2号棟 4階音楽室(江別市文京台23番地)



【対象】重い病気や障がいのあるこどもとそのご家族。

※車椅子のおともだちや、きょうだいさんも参加できます。

※心配なおともだちは事前にご連絡ください。


【参加費】 家族全員無料
